This exam is a national level exam which conducts by University Grants Commission every year. UGC NET Exam is for Post Graduate candidates to qualify for university level teaching jobs in India and also to take admissions in good university on PhD level programmes. National Eligibility Test is conducted in Humanities (including languages), Social Sciences, Forensic Science, Environmental Sciences, Computer Science and Applications and Electronic Science.

UGC NET Exam will be operated in 3 question papers as UGC NET Commerce Paper I, Paper II and Paper III.
Paper I: This paper will assess the applicants reasoning ability, comprehension, divergent thinking and general awareness. There will be 60 questions, each of two marks. The applicants have to answer 50 questions only.Paper - II: Paper - II will be based on the subject chosen by the applicants. There will 50 questions of two marks each. All the questions are compulsory.Paper – III: This will consist of 150 marks and will have questions from the subject the applier has chosen. There will 75 objective-type questions of two marks each.
